.icon-circle-wrapper{position:relative;display:flex;align-items:center;justify-content:center;width:36px;min-width:36px;height:36px;border-radius:50%;overflow:hidden;svg{width:55%;height:55%}}.landing_hero-section__hI8oh{position:relative;color:#fff;height:600px;max-height:calc(100vh - 115px);@supports (height:100dvh){max-height:calc(100dvh - 60px)}.landing_slide-img__kql_N{position:relative;width:100%;height:100%;&:after{content:"";position:absolute;width:100%;height:100%;top:0;left:0;background-color:rgba(0,0,0,.4);z-index:1}}.landing_hero_content___Th0f{position:absolute;top:0;left:0;display:flex;flex-direction:column;align-items:center;justify-content:center;width:100%;height:100%;gap:1.4rem;z-index:3}.landing_carousel-next-btn__6UBkl,.landing_carousel-prev-btn__t2b_2{inset-inline-end:3rem;border:1px solid #fff;background-color:transparent;color:#fff!important}.landing_carousel-prev-btn__t2b_2{inset-inline-start:3rem}}.landing_section_wrapper__kRttA:not(.landing_hero-section__hI8oh){padding-block:var(--section-padding)}.landing_image_gradient_wrapper__kGcXp{position:relative;width:100%;height:100%;object-fit:cover;&: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;z-index:2;background:linear-gradient(180deg,transparent 41.38%,rgba(0,0,0,.9))}}.landing_section_top_gap__NPbqP{margin-top:100px}.landing_section_packges_top_gap__3y_eq{margin-top:50px auto}.landing_tours_gap__UXA84{margin-top:100px}.landing_serviceImage__G4gKF{transition:.3s ease-in-out;border:1px solid transparent}.landing_serviceImage__G4gKF>div{width:95%;height:95%;transition:.4s ease-in-out}.landing_serviceImage__G4gKF:hover{border-color:rgba(var(--primary-color),1)}.landing_serviceImage__G4gKF:hover>div{width:100%;height:100%}.landing_aboutUs_image__DYp7R{position:absolute;z-index:10;top:0;right:20px;height:457px}.landing_aboutUs_content__eQ3LH{white-space:pre-line}.landing_hotelSection__WHi9Z{margin-top:100px;background-image:url(/_next/static/media/servicesBG.99b79eae.png);background-size:contain}.landing_carousel__84Jk_{margin-bottom:-200px}.landing_carousel_arrows__BkTvb{position:unset!important}.landing_flights_image__ZvAlW{position:absolute;z-index:10;top:0;left:20px;height:457px}@media (max-width:991px){.landing_flights_image__ZvAlW{top:10px;right:10px;left:10px;bottom:10px;height:unset}}@media (max-width:768px){.landing_aboutUs_image__DYp7R{height:auto}}